The maximum number of individuals of a species that an environment can support sustainably.

What is a host in an ecosystem relationship?
Back
An organism that is used by a parasite for food or shelter, often harmed in the process.

What are limiting factors?
Back
Conditions that prevent a population from growing larger, such as food availability, disease, and predation.

What is competition in an ecosystem?
Back
A relationship where two or more species fight for the same resources, such as food, water, or space.

What is a symbiotic relationship?
Back
A close interaction between two different species, which can be beneficial, harmful, or neutral.

What is mutualism?
Back
A type of symbiotic relationship where both species benefit, such as bees pollinating flowers.

What is predation?
Back
An interaction where one organism (the predator) kills and eats another organism (the prey).
